The maintenance reminder is not the result of an engine problem. It's telling you that service is required (oil change or more) based on the miles and your driving habits. It is unrelated to the test pipe though it is likely you will need to install an anti-fouler to trick the ECU into believing the non-existent cat is working as well as the OEM cat, which obviously it's not going to do.
